TWEETS GENERATE CO2

The energy it takes to send a tweet generates .02 grams of CO2.1 With 500 million tweets sent daily2, a total of 10 metric tons of CO2 are emitted per day.



HUMAN FARTS

Did you know? Human farts produce CO2 and on average, contain about the same amount of CO2 as tweet farts do.3 It’s true.

Tweets, likes, and Google searches are powered by data centers, buildings that house thousands of servers and consume huge amounts of electricity. The generation of this electricity produces CO2. Find out what companies like Facebook and Google are doing about it.
